Интерфейсы языка RSL для взаимодействия с АС RS-Loans V.6

Скачать документ(Loans_RSLprc.pdf, 2659065)
Тип документа:Руководство программиста
Продукт:RS-Bank V.6.20.031.92
Разделы:Tools
Дата документа:07.04.2025

Описание документа

Настоящее Руководство содержит описание переменных, классов, процедур и констант языка интерпретатора RSL, которые используются при создании макромодулей, входящих в АС RS-Loans V.6 ИБС RS-Bank V.6, и при написании пользователем собственных макропрограмм.

Изменения документа

  • 07.04.2025
    • изменено
      • Изменены контактные данные компании на последней странице.
  • 26.09.2024
    • изменено
      • В главу "Модуль SbCrdInter" в раздел "Процедуры\Процедуры для работы со счетами\Процедура НайтиСчет" добавлено примечание об использовании процедуры только на шагах операции, а также доработан пример использования.
  • 28.06.2024
    • изменено
      • Изменены контактные данные компании.
        Доработано в связи с импортозамещением.
  • 01.09.2023
    • изменено
      • Изменены контактные данные компании на последней странице.
  • 29.05.2023
    • изменено
      • В главе "Модуль SbCrdInter" доработана информация раздела "Процедуры\ Процедура выполнения операции из макроса MakeOperation".
  • 16.12.2022
    • добавлено
      • В главу "Пакет LoansConst" в раздел "Константы" добавлены следующие подразделы:
        • "Значение параметра «Учет ВЗ в расчете ПСК» (DDUTSTAGE_DBT.T_USE_IN_PSK)".
        • "Статус реестра цессий".
    • изменено
      • Изменены контактные данные компании.
      • В главу "Пакет LoansConst" в раздел "Константы\ Системные виды операций" добавлено описание константы CS_DISCOUNTING_ACQRNG_DEM.
      • В главу "Пакет LOANSENSURE" в раздел "Функции" добавлено описание функций CalcSumBorrow, CalcSumEnsUnbal_Distr, CalcSumOD, CalcSumPerc, CalcSumODPerc, GetHCostOOSum_OnKDinDO, GetNumberLinkedKD_GD_Claim.
      • В главу "Пакет LoansOperation" в раздел "Процедуры" добавлено описание процедуры Set_StepAcc.
      • В главу "Пакет RSO_LN_CESSIO" в раздел "Функции" внесены следующие изменения:
      • добавлено описание функций CalcPriceAndSelling, CalcPriceContr, GetStatusCessRegister, GetDateDealCessRegister, LastBindedCessDog;
      • доработано описание функций CalcPriceAndSelling, LastBindedCess.
      • В главу "Пакет RSO_Loans_FNS" в раздел "Функции" добавлено описание функций isDepTrffMore1perc, SumSUPERFLUOUS_PERC_EXPC.
  • 11.10.2022
    • изменено
      • Доработан раздел "Модуль SbCrdInter\ Процедуры\ Процедура выполнения операции из макроса MakeOperation\ Для закрытия договора".
  • 29.08.2022
    • добавлено
      • В главу "Модуль SbCrdInter" добавлен раздел "Процедуры\ Процедура выполнения операции из макроса MakeOperation\ Для списания задолженности за счет резерва".
  • 31.05.2022
    • изменено
      • Изменены контактные данные компании на последней странице.
  • 24.09.2021
    • изменено
      • Константа CF_REZ137P изменена на CF_REZ232P в разделах:
      • "Модуль SbCrdInter"\Процедуры\Процедура выполнения операции из макроса MakeOperation".
      • "Модуль SbCrdInter"\Процедуры\Процедура выполнения операции из макроса MakeOperation\Для формирования резерва РВП".
      • Изменены контактные данные компании на последней странице.
  • 20.10.2020
    • изменено
      • Изменены стили руководства.
  • 01.09.2020
    • изменено
      • RS-Securities V.6 и RS-Dealing V.6 переименованы в RS-FinMarkets.
  • 28.05.2020
    • изменено
      • В главу "Модуль SbCRDInter" в раздел "Константы\ Виды документов выгрузки" добавлено описание константы IgAlgoID_OPC.
  • 11.09.2019
    • изменено
      • На последней странице изменены контактные данные компании.
  • 06.11.2018
    • изменено
      • Изменена информация на второй странице руководства.
  • 19.09.2018
    • добавлено
      • В главу "Модуль SbCrdInter" добавлен раздел "Процедуры\ Процедура выполнения операции из макроса MakeOperation\ Для принятия дополнительного соглашения".
    • изменено
      • В главу "Модуль SbCRDInter" внесены следующие изменения:
      • В разделе "Процедуры\ Процедура выполнения операции из макроса MakeOperation":
      • доработано описание операции пролонгации;
      • доработано описание операции расчета/перерасчета графиков погашения.
      • Из раздела "Процедуры\ Процедуры выполнения шагов маршрутов" удалено описание процедуры ОпределениеСледующегоШага.
      • В разделе "Процедуры\ Процедуры для работы с банковскими картами" доработано описание процедуры УдалитьКарту.
      • В раздел "Процедуры\ Процедуры для работы со счетами" добавлено описание процедур DeleteSPIAccount, InsertSPIAccount, UpdateSPIAccount.

  • 09.04.2018
    • изменено
      • В главе "Модуль SbCRDInter" в разделе "Процедуры\ Процедура выполнения операции из макроса MakeOperation" доработано описание процедуры Для расчета/перерасчета графиков погашения.
  • 01.06.2017
    • добавлено
      • В главу "Модуль SbCrdInter" в раздел "Константы" добавлены следующие подразделы:
      • "Ключевание счетов".
      • "Признаки однородности портфеля".
      • Добавлена глава "Модуль LoansGUI", в которую из раздела "Процедуры" главы "Модуль SbCrdInter" перенесены следующие процедуры: ВвестиПериодДат, УстановитьВидыКредитов, УстановитьДоговора, УстановитьКлиентов, УстановитьТипыСчетов, УстановитьФилиалы, ViewPanel. Для процедуры ViewPanel добавлено описание примера.
    • изменено
      • В главу "Модуль SbCrdInter" в раздел "Процедуры\ Процедуры для работы со счетами" добавлено описание процедуры КлючеватьСчетПоФилиалу и изменено описание процедуры КлючеватьСчет.
  • 01.03.2017
    • изменено
      • В главу "Модуль SbCrdInter" добавлено описание констант CF_CHANGE_SUM, CF_CLOSEDRAFT, CF_DRAFTOPEN, OP_RESERVEACC, CS_CHANGE_SUM, CS_CLOSEDRAFTCONTR, CS_OPENDRAFTCONTR.
  • 23.12.2016
    • изменено
      • В главу "Модуль SbCrdInter" добавлено описание процедуры GetTrffRateStr.
      • Изменены контактные данные компании на последней странице.
  • 23.12.2016
    • добавлено
    • изменено
      • В главу "Модуль SbCrdInter" добавлено описание констант CF_CHANGE_SUM, CF_CLOSEDRAFT, CF_DRAFTOPEN, OP_RESERVEACC, CS_CHANGE_SUM, CS_CLOSEDRAFTCONTR, CS_OPENDRAFTCONTR.
  • 28.06.2016
    • изменено
      • В раздел "Модуль SbCrdInter\Процедуры" внесены следующие изменения:
      • В раздел "Процедура выполнения операции из макроса MakeOperation\Для изменения процентных ставок по видам тарифов" добавлен второй пример использования функции.
      • В раздел "Процедуры для работы с резервами" доработано описание возвращаемого значения функции НомерПортфеляОбязательства.
  • 20.04.2016
    • изменено
      • В разделе "Модуль SbCrdInter\ Процедуры\ Процедура выполнения операции из макроса MakeOperation\ Для погашения" добавлено описание необходимости вызова процедуры OpenLoansCommonFiles () при использовании операции погашения, если включена связка с RS-Retail и запуск операции выполняется в транзакции, а также изменён пример использования процедуры.
      • В разделе "Модуль SbCrdInter\ Процедуры\ Процедура выполнения операции из макроса MakeOperation\ Для изменения процентных ставок по видам тарифов" изменён пример использования процедуры.
      • Изменено название раздела "Модуль SbCrdInter\ Процедуры\ Процедура выполнения операции из макроса MakeOperation\ Для перечисления процентов по депозиту" на "Модуль SbCrdInter\ Процедуры\ Процедура выполнения операции из макроса MakeOperation\ Для причисления процентов по депозиту".
  • 07.04.2015
    • добавлено
      • Добавлены разделы:
      • "Модуль SbCrdInter\ Процедуры\ Процедура выполнения операции из макроса MakeOperation\ Для реструктуризации кредита".
      • "Модуль SbCrdInter\ Процедуры\ Процедура выполнения операции из макроса MakeOperation\ Для сокращения срока договора".
    • изменено
      • В разделе "Модуль SbCrdInter\ Константы\ Виды операций" изменено описание константы CF_SHORT.
      • В разделе "Модуль SbCrdInter\ Константы\ Виды тарифов" удалено описание констант TRU_EXPDEPO и TRU_EXPPERCDEPO.
      • В разделе "Модуль SbCrdInter\ Процедуры\ Процедура выполнения операции из макроса MakeOperation" произведены следующие изменения:
      • добавлено описание констант CF_RESTRUCTURE и CF_SHORT;
      • изменено описание констант CF_RATE и OP_RAT;
      • удалено описание констант CF_ALG и CF_ALGS.

      • В разделе "Модуль SbCrdInter\ Процедуры\ Процедура выполнения операции из макроса MakeOperation\ Для изменения значений тарифов по объектам" изменено описание примера использования процедуры MakeOperation().
      • В раздел "Модуль SbCrdInter\ Процедуры\ Прочие процедуры" добавлено описание процедур:
      • CalcDischType().
      • CalcDischSum().
      • CheckDisch().
      • SendBki().
      • ДобавитьПараметры().
      • В раздел "Модуль total.mac\ Процедуры" добавлено описание параметра GroupNum и примера использования процедуры GetUsFieldValue().
      • Переименованы разделы:
      • "Модуль SbCrdInter\ Процедуры\ Процедура выполнения операции из макроса MakeOperation\ Виды тарифных ставок по видам кредита" в "Модуль SbCrdInter\ Процедуры\ Процедура выполнения операции из макроса MakeOperation\ Виды тарифных ставок по видам тарифов".
      • "Модуль SbCrdInter\ Константы\ Виды процентных ставок" в "Модуль SbCrdInter\ Константы\ Виды тарифов".
    • удалено
      • Удалены разделы:
      • "Модуль SbCrdInter\ Константы\ Процентные ставки".
      • "Модуль SbCrdInter\ Процедуры\ Процедура выполнения операции из макроса MakeOperation\ Для изменения алгоритма расчета процентов по объектам".
  • 04.09.2014
    • изменено
      • В главе "Модуль SbCrdInter" в разделе "Процедуры\Процедура выполнения операции из макроса MakeOperation\Для изменения процентных ставок по объектам" доработано описание параметров процедуры и пример использования.
  • 19.06.2014
    • изменено
      • В главу "Модуль SbCrdInter" внесены следующие изменения:
      • В раздел "Процедуры\Прочие процедуры" добавлено описание функции GetNameAlg().
      • В разделе "Процедуры\Процедура выполнения операции из макроса MakeOperation\Для изменения категории качества по 232-П" актуализирован пример.
  • 08.04.2013
    • изменено
      • Добавлен раздел "Модуль SbCrdInter\ Процедуры\ Процедуры для работы с интеграционными сервисами".